lingvist.info features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Lingvist.info has a clean and int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to navigate through the website and access the language learning resources they need.
  • Comprehensive Language Courses
    The platform offers a wide range of language courses that cover vocabulary, grammar, and pronunciation, providing users with a well-rounded language learning experience.
  • Adaptive Learning Technology
    Lingvist.info uses adaptive learning technology to personalize the learning experience, allowing users to focus on the areas where they need the most improvement.
  • Mobile Accessibility
    The website is accessible on mobile devices, enabling users to learn languages on the go and seamlessly continue their studies across different platforms.

Possible disadvantages of lingvist.info

  • Limited Free Content
    While Lingvist.info offers some free content, the majority of the comprehensive lessons and advanced features require a subscription, which might be a drawback for users seeking free resources.
  • Internet Dependency
    Since Lingvist.info is web-based, users need a stable internet connection to access the courses, which may be inconvenient for learners without reliable internet access.
  • Language Availability
    The platform may not offer as many language options as other larger language learning websites, limiting choices for users interested in less commonly taught languages.
  • Focus on Vocabulary
    The program places a strong emphasis on vocabulary acquisition, which might not be as beneficial for learners looking to improve their conversational skills or comprehension in a more holistic manner.

CommitCat features and specs

  • Simplified Git Interface
    CommitCat aims to provide a user-friendly graphical interface for Git, making version control more accessible to developers who may find the command line intimidating or cumbersome.
  • Free and Open Source
    CommitCat is offered as a free tool, lowering the barrier to entry for individuals and small teams who need a Git client without the cost associated with some commercial alternatives.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    CommitCat is designed to work across multiple operating systems, allowing developers on different platforms to use the same familiar tool for their version control needs.
  • Beginner-Friendly
    The tool is positioned to help newcomers to Git and version control by providing a more visual and intuitive way to manage repositories, commits, and branches without needing deep command-line expertise.
  • Lightweight Application
    CommitCat is designed to be a lightweight Git client that doesn't consume excessive system resources, making it suitable for developers who prefer a lean, fast tool over feature-heavy alternatives.

Possible disadvantages of CommitCat

  • Limited Feature Set
    Compared to more established Git clients like GitKraken, Sourcetree, or Fork, CommitCat may lack advanced features such as built-in merge conflict resolution tools, advanced branch visualization, or deep integration with CI/CD pipelines.
  • Small Community and Ecosystem
    As a lesser-known tool, CommitCat has a smaller user community, which means fewer tutorials, community-driven plugins, and peer support compared to mainstream Git clients.
  • Limited Visibility and Traction
    CommitCat appears to have limited online presence and user reviews, making it difficult for potential users to assess its reliability, maturity, and long-term viability before adopting it.
  • Uncertain Development Activity
    It is unclear how actively CommitCat is being maintained and developed. A tool with infrequent updates may fall behind in compatibility with newer Git features or operating system updates.
  • Lack of Enterprise Features
    CommitCat may not offer enterprise-grade features such as team collaboration tools, access control integrations, or support for large-scale repository management that organizations often require.
